Position Overview
Kiewit Industrial & Water Engineering (KIWE) is seeking a Process Engineer Intern to be a part of our growing Engineering team that is developing industrial and water infrastructure solutions across North America. You will assist with small projects, or as a part of a large multi-discipline team on larger projects, to develop conceptual and detailed designs and calculations to support the project execution using current drawing and technical tools/programs/software with a focus on design documentation creation/layout.
District Overview
Kiewit Engineering Group, Inc is a full-service consulting and engineering firm serving the infrastructure and energy markets. Our combined staff of more than 3,700 engineers and design professionals have expertise that spans all major engineering disciplines to serve industrial, transportation, power, water, mining, marine, building and oil, gas & chemical markets. Backed by over 140 years of construction experience, our construction-driven engineering focuses on constructability and safety in the earliest phases of projects to ensure on-time and on-budget project delivery.
Our rapidly growing Industrial and Water Engineering Group, which includes process, mechanical, electrical, controls, structural and architectural disciplines, is a multi-faceted and leading-edge division of Kiewit with best-in-class technical expertise focused on EPC and design-build delivery. The Industrial Group projects span markets such as advanced technologies; industrial energy; drinking water; wastewater treatment and biosolids; desalination; industrial water; mining, minerals and metals; and process industries.

Responsibilities
• Work within a multi-disciplinary team of engineers and designers to execute design and engineering on projects
• Assist with the design of industrial water/wastewater systems, water/wastewater treatment systems, desalination systems, biogas, bulk solids material handling, pump stations and pipeline conveyance, groundwater remediation, stormwater recycling, and other industrial facilities including, but not limited to, process piping, conveying systems, dust collection, general plant/facility utilities, compressed air, steam, and gas systems
• Assist with preparing water mass balances, process flow diagrams (PFDs) and piping and instrument diagrams (P&IDs) for system technologies including coagulation, flocculation, filtration, reverse osmosis (industrial and desalination), ion exchange, condensate polishing, wastewater treatment, chemical handling/storage/injection, sampling and analysis and other industrial systems including, but not limited to, bulk solids conveyors, dust collection equipment, bins/tanks, pumps, heat exchangers, boilers, and other process equipment.
• Assist with preparing design deliverables in accordance with industry codes and standards, contract requirements, and company standards.
• Uses specific software packages for process systems and hydraulics modeling and scenario studies (Aspen, HYSYS, etc.)
• Assist in the preparation, monitoring, and updating of project plans, schedules, and budgets in coordination with project discipline leadership to ensure successful project completion.
